Today, we want to share some valuable tips on how you can start a company as a side-hustle and make the leap to full-time when you have gained traction.

Define Your Vision and Goals: Clearly define your vision for the company and set realistic goals. Having a clear understanding of what you want to achieve will help you stay focused and make effective decisions while juggling your side-hustle with other commitments.


Start with a Solid Foundation: Lay the groundwork for your company by conducting market research, identifying your target audience, and developing a minimum viable product (MVP) or service. Validate your concept and gather feedback from early adopters to ensure there is a demand for what you're offering.


Effective Time Management: Balancing a side-hustle with other responsibilities requires effective time management. Create a schedule and allocate dedicated time slots for working on your business. Prioritise tasks and make the most of every available minute to move your company forward.


Leverage Your Existing Network: Tap into your personal and professional network to gain initial traction. Seek referrals, partnerships, or mentorship from individuals who can provide support, guidance, and potential customer connections. Utilise online platforms and social media to expand your reach.


Test and Iterate: As you gain traction, continue testing and iterating your product or service based on customer feedback. This allows you to refine and improve your offering while keeping a pulse on the market. Use customer insights to drive your decision-making and shape the direction of your company.


Monitor Traction and Milestones: Set measurable milestones for your side-hustle and closely monitor your progress. Keep an eye on key metrics such as user acquisition, revenue, customer feedback, or any other indicators relevant to your business. Significant traction can serve as validation and a signal that it may be time to transition to full-time entrepreneurship.


Build a Financial Safety Net: Before making the leap to full-time entrepreneurship, ensure you have a financial safety net in place. Save an emergency fund to cover your personal expenses during the transition period or consider securing alternative income streams to support yourself.


Plan Your Transition Strategically: Plan your transition from side-hustle to full-time entrepreneurship strategically. Identify the milestones or financial goals that indicate it's the right time to make the switch. Consider the impact on your personal and professional commitments and make the transition with confidence.


Remember, building a successful company as a side-hustle requires determination, discipline, and effective time management. With the right mindset, planning, and execution, you can turn your passion project into a thriving business while managing other commitments.
